Output 59c4a031cc03178244072706707643863aa3c647b2c88dfdaf2e76227af9e47e:58

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ab3c20296c4d63a0d7bb75b4db17e7e6ad115909b6bf1e6c973d560ae6f4ac46
address
bc1p4v7zq2tvf436p4amwk6dk9l8u6k3zkgfk6l3umyh84tq4eh543rq8sknl6
transaction
59c4a031cc03178244072706707643863aa3c647b2c88dfdaf2e76227af9e47e
spent
true